The peaceloving alchemist Rickard Pike was in a field one afternoon trying
desperately to crack the mystery of the luminescent Phospherous Root when he
suddenly was konged on the head by a piece of debris fallen from the sky.
Studying the curious green, glowing rock he soon realised that it was indeed
a piece of Godrock, the remains of a mountain imbued with the essence of
gods. This was such a wonderous discovery that he raced home as fast as he
could to tell everyone.

As Rickard Pike arived that evening to tell of his great discovery he found
himself transformed into a gigantic flying, feathered squid. Now, whenever
Rickard Pike is exposed to light, the peaceloving alchemist is metamorphed
by the essence of a dark god into the twisted half-eagle, half-squid hybrid:
The Demented Squeagle.


The Squeagle

Gargantuan Magical Beast (Aquatic)
Hit Dice: 20d10+140 (250 hp)
Initiative: +2 (Dex)
Speed: Swim 20 ft. Fly 60 ft. (average)
AC: 22 (-4 size, +2 Dex, +14 natural)
Attacks: 2 tentacle rakes +28 melee, 6 arms +23 melee, _bite +23 melee
Damage: Tentacle rake 2d8+12, arm 1d6+6, bite 4d6+6
Face/Reach: 20 ft. by 40 ft./"_10 ft. (100 ft. with tentacle)
Special Attacks: Improved grab, constrict 2d8+12 or 1d6+6, Snatch
Special Qualities: Jet, ink cloud, Darkness Vulnerability
Saves: Fort +19, Ref +14, Will +13
Abilities: Str 34, Dex 15, Con 24, Int 16, Wis 13, Cha 11
Skills: Knowledge (geography) +8, Knowledge (nature) +8, Listen +16, Search
+16, Spot +16
Feats: Alertness, Blind-Fight, Expertise, Improved Critical_(tentacle), Iron
Will

Climate/Terrain: Temperate, warm mountains, or any aquatic
Organization: Solitary or swarm (2-200)
Challenge Rating: 13
Treasure: Double standard
Alignment: Always neutral evil
Advancement: 21-32 HD (Gargantuan); 33-60 HD (Colossal)

Squeagles speak Aquan and Auran.

Combat

The Squeagle often attacks from the air, swooping earthward to snatch prey
in its powerful tentacles and carry its prize off to its aquatic home for a
proper feast. An airborne Squeagle is typically hunting and will attack any
Medium-size or larger creature that appears edible. The Squeagle strikes its
opponent with its barbed tentacles, then grabs and crushes with its arms or
drags victims into its huge beak.

Improved Grab (Ex): To use this ability, The Squeagle must hit an opponent
of up to Huge size with an arm or tentacle attack. If it gets a hold, it can
constrict.

Constrict (Ex): The Squeagle deals automatic arm or tentacle damage with a
successful grapple check against Huge or smaller creatures.

Jet (Ex): When underwater, The Squeagle can jet backward once per round as a
double move action, at a speed of 280 feet.

Ink Cloud (Ex): The Squeagle can emit a cloud of jet-black ink 80 feet high
by 80 feet wide by 120 feet long once per minute as a free action. The cloud
provides total concealment, which the kraken normally uses to escape a
losing fight. Creatures within the cloud suffer the effects of total
darkness.

Snatch (Ex): When the Squeagle hits a creature of at least Small size, but
no larger than Huge, with a tentacle attack, it attempts to start a grapple
as a free action without provoking an attack of opportunity. If The Squeagle
achieves a hold, it can fly off with its prey and automatically make a bite
attack each round in lieu of a tentacle attack. It can drop a snatched
creature as a free action or use a standard action to fling it aside. A
flung creature travels 90 feet and takes 9d6 points of damage. If the roc
flings it while flying, the creature suffers this amount of damage or
falling damage, whichever is greater.

Darkness Vulnerability (Su): Whenever The Squeagle is not exposed to at
least some tiny amount of natural or magical light (the effect of the Ink
Cloud do not cause this), the powerful abomination is transformed into the
peaceloving alchemist Rickard Pike, who, of course, in the tradition of such
things, is an annoying, pacifist, lawful good character who will have no
memory of the events that happened during the time he was The Demented
Squeagle. Exposure to light will heal him of this awful affliction,
returning him to his true form once more.
